Jul 21, 2022 · Analytical thinking is the ability to assess and process information, and it's a crucial skill when solving problems. You can use analytical thinking to assess the initial problem, analyse the evidence or data and evaluate the possible solutions. This can help you create an effective solution for each obstacle.

A heuristic is another type of problem solving strategy. While an algorithm must be followed exactly to produce a correct result, a heuristic is a general problem-solving framework (Tversky & Kahneman, 1974). You can think of these as mental shortcuts that are used to solve problems. Brainstorming is a well-known technique that leverages the interaction between a group of people to create solutions by building on one another's ideas. For more effective brainstorming, use this technique with a group of about five to seven participants.

During this step, a group should analyze the problem and the group’s relationship to the problem. Whereas the first step involved exploring the “what” related to the problem, this step focuses on the “why.”.
